What is it

Acoustic barrier + bifacial PV in a single engineered structure.

Yukings solar photovoltaic noise barriers pair a high-performance absorptive or hybrid acoustic panel structure (80-140 mm depth, 25-42 dB insertion loss) with bifacial monocrystalline silicon PV modules mounted on the road-facing or rear face. The integrated system delivers simultaneous road-traffic noise reduction for receivers and renewable electricity generation feeding into grid-tie inverters and medium-voltage grid connections. Built to T/CIET group standard for road traffic photovoltaic noise barrier power generation engineering with full project-specific system design.

Technical Specification

Full specification for Solar PV Noise Barriers

Solar Photovoltaic Noise Barriers — Product Specification

PropertyValue
Insertion Loss DL (EN 1793-3)25 – 42 dB
Sound Insulation Rw (EN ISO 717-1)32 – 48 dB
PV Module TypeMonocrystalline bifacial silicon
PV Module Power Range420 – 540 W per module
Panel Size (acoustic + PV)2,000 mm x 1,000 mm (6 ft 7 in x 3 ft 3 in) standard
Panel Depth80 – 140 mm acoustic + 35 mm PV module
H-post Column SizeH 125 x 125 x 6.5 x 9 mm to H 200 x 200 x 9 x 14 mm
H-post Spacing2.0 m or 2.5 m bays
Barrier Height3.0 – 5.0 m (project-specific to 8.0 m by request)
Inverter TypeGrid-tie string inverter — project specified
Grid ConnectionMedium-voltage (MV) — project specified
Design Service Life25 years (acoustic + PV structure)
PV Linear Power Warranty25 years — minimum 80% rated power output
Structural Warranty15 years on Yukings-supplied structural elements
Wind Load Rating1.2 kN/m2 (EN 1991-1-4)
Fire RatingClass A (EN 13501-1)
FinishHot-dip galvanized + optional RAL powder coat
ComplianceT/CIET group standard for road traffic PV noise barrier power generation engineering

Solar PV Noise Barriers — FAQs

How much electricity does a solar PV noise barrier generate?

Power generation depends on module wattage (420-540 W standard), barrier length, local latitude/irradiance and orientation. As a guideline each kilometre of Yukings solar PV barrier generates significant renewable megawatt-hours annually — we provide detailed PV energy yield simulation for every project based on your site geographic data, including bifacial albedo-gain estimates.

Does the PV module layer reduce the acoustic performance of the barrier?

No. The bifacial PV modules are mounted on dedicated structural rails separate from the acoustic panel layer. The acoustic barrier itself (80-140 mm absorptive or hybrid panel) maintains its full EN 1793-3 acoustic performance of 25-42 dB insertion loss independently of the PV system. The complete structure is tested to ensure acoustic integrity is not compromised.

What warranties and power performance guarantees are available?

Yukings solar PV noise barriers come with a 25-year linear PV power warranty guaranteeing minimum 80% rated power output at year 25. On the Yukings-supplied structural elements (H-posts, panel frames, mounting rails) we provide a 15-year structural warranty. The complete acoustic structure has a 25-year design service life consistent with our standard noise barrier & acoustic barrier products.

What engineering documentation and compliance standards apply?

Yukings solar PV noise barriers are engineered in compliance with the T/CIET group standard for road traffic photovoltaic noise barrier power generation engineering. Additional documentation includes full structural wind-load analysis to EN 1991-1-4, complete EN 1793-3 acoustic performance dossier, PV system single-line diagrams, medium-voltage (MV) grid connection specifications and commissioning checklists for turnkey handover.
